您的要求很有趣。所以你需要同时播放和录音,对吧?
因此,您需要使用类别 AVAudioSessionCategoryPlayAndRecord 初始化音频会话。
[[AVAudioSession sharedInstance] setCategory:AVAudioSessionCategoryPlayAndRecord error:&error];
因为您使用UIImagePickerController 进行录音,所以您对扬声器和麦克风没有太多控制权。所以测试一下,看看它是否有效。
如果你还是有问题,建议你使用AVCaptureSession录制没有音频的视频。看看这个例子怎么用record-video-with-avcapturesession-2。
更新:在我的 VOIP 应用程序中,我使用AVAudioUnit 在播放时进行录制。所以我认为唯一的方法是分别录制视频和音频,然后使用AVComposition 将其组合成一部电影。使用AVCaptureSession 仅录制视频,使用EZAudio 录制音频。 EZAudio 使用 AVAudioUnit 进行记录,以便它应该工作。您可以通过在播放电影时录制音频来测试它,看看它是否有效。我希望它会有所帮助
更新:我测试过,它只有在您使用耳机或选择麦克风时才有效。
以下是测试代码:
NSString *moviePath = [[NSBundle mainBundle] pathForResource:@"videoviewdemo" ofType:@"mp4"];
NSURL *url = [NSURL fileURLWithPath:moviePath];
// You may find a test stream at <http://devimages.apple.com/iphone/samples/bipbop/bipbopall.m3u8>.
AVPlayerItem *playerItem = [AVPlayerItem playerItemWithURL:url];
AVPlayer *player = [AVPlayer playerWithPlayerItem:playerItem];
AVPlayerLayer *layer = [[AVPlayerLayer alloc] init];
[layer setPlayer:player];
[layer setFrame:CGRectMake(0, 0, 100, 100)];
[self.view.layer addSublayer:layer];
[player play];
dispatch_after(dispatch_time(DISPATCH_TIME_NOW, (int64_t)(1 * NSEC_PER_SEC)), dispatch_get_main_queue(), ^{
//
// Setup the AVAudioSession. EZMicrophone will not work properly on iOS
// if you don't do this!
//
AVAudioSession *session = [AVAudioSession sharedInstance];
NSError *error;
[session setCategory:AVAudioSessionCategoryPlayAndRecord error:&error];
if (error)
{
NSLog(@"Error setting up audio session category: %@", error.localizedDescription);
}
[session setActive:YES error:&error];
if (error)
{
NSLog(@"Error setting up audio session active: %@", error.localizedDescription);
}
//
// Customizing the audio plot's look
//
// Background color
self.audioPlot.backgroundColor = [UIColor colorWithRed:0.984 green:0.471 blue:0.525 alpha:1.0];
// Waveform color
self.audioPlot.color = [UIColor colorWithRed:1.0 green:1.0 blue:1.0 alpha:1.0];
// Plot type
self.audioPlot.plotType = EZPlotTypeBuffer;
//
// Create the microphone
//
self.microphone = [EZMicrophone microphoneWithDelegate:self];
//
// Set up the microphone input UIPickerView items to select
// between different microphone inputs. Here what we're doing behind the hood
// is enumerating the available inputs provided by the AVAudioSession.
//
self.inputs = [EZAudioDevice inputDevices];
self.microphoneInputPickerView.dataSource = self;
self.microphoneInputPickerView.delegate = self;
//
// Start the microphone
//
[self.microphone startFetchingAudio];
self.microphoneTextLabel.text = @"Microphone On";
[[AVAudioSession sharedInstance] overrideOutputAudioPort:AVAudioSessionPortOverrideSpeaker error:nil];
});
